| Senior Post High School Plans | |||
| 2000-01 | 2001-02 | 2002-03 | |
| University/College | 78% | 66% | 82% |
| Full-Time Job | 33% | 31% | 30% |
| Part-Time Job | 49% | 50% | 52% |
| Military | 2% | 1% | 2% |
| Other | 2% | 2% | 2% |
| Undecided | 11% | 12% | 11% |
| Note: Yearly totals exceed 100 percent because of students who plan to both work and attend college. | |||
